Don currently serves as Chief Operations Officer for PMA Consultants. He is also the Executive Director of PMA’s National Claims Practice, mentoring and directing PMA business units on disputed changes/claims avoidance and analysis and expert witness services. Don brings extensive experience in program, project, and construction management, with large contractors and as a PM/CM consultant. Don has worked in diverse markets, including water/wastewater, manufacturing and process, infrastructure, oil and gas and energy, transportation/transit (air and rail), and environmental projects.
PMA’s continued growth in Alameda County and in the East Bay area required a new office to maintain our standard of providing excellent customer service. The new East Bay office is located in downtown Oakland and offers quick access to construction sites and clients and to the homes of PMA employees living in the area. Conveniently located near freeways and public transportation, the PMA Oakland location has earned a reputation for its artistic culture and walkable access to eclectic restaurants and art galleries. Portfolio projects in this region include clients in utilities, transportation, and port sectors.
